At Microsoft Ignite 2018, Microsoft has announced a new way for learning Azure, Business Applications like Power BI and Dynamics and for Visual Studio called Microsoft Learn! Microsoft Learn delivers over 80 hours of learning material in 23 different languages and best of all – Microsoft Learn is free!

Right after the release of Microsoft learn it was already loaded with modules. At this time there are 74 modules coming from setting up your first virtual machine all the way to designing for security. You can browse in the learning catalog based on your job role (like Administrator, Developer or Architect), your knowledge level and/or the product you want to learn about.

If you are new to Azure and do not have an Azure subscription you’ll usually need to grab your credit card and mobile number to get going with an Azure account. This is probably something you do not want to do if you are just want to learn. So Microsoft has made it possible to start learning on Azure with a sandbox account without the need of a creditcard!

Active the sandbox environment and test with REAL Azure services

Next to the sandbox account the Azure CLI is also integrated in the learning environment, so you could work on your scripting knowledge – without the need of installing anything.
